Abstract

This study assessed the leadership preferences of police officers' stakeholders in understanding the leadership styles of Pangasinan's Commissioned Police Officers. The respondents for the interview and survey using stratified random selection techniques; were PNP stakeholders from Tayug and Urdaneta Pangasinan. Their responses were collated and submitted to content analysis to identify their ideal police leadership style.
